Responsibilities:

  1. Project Leadership: Take ownership of flat roofing and waterproofing projects, providing strategic direction and leadership to ensure objectives are met on time and within budget.
  2. Site Supervision: Manage day-to-day site activities, including coordinating subcontractors, scheduling deliveries, and overseeing the installation of waterproofing systems to ensure compliance with design specifications and quality standards.
  3. Resource Management: Allocate labour, equipment, and materials effectively to optimize productivity and minimize waste, while adhering to project budgets and timelines.
  4. Health and Safety Compliance: Enforce strict adherence to health and safety protocols and regulations on-site, conducting regular inspections and implementing corrective actions to mitigate risks and ensure a safe working environment for all personnel.
  5. Quality Assurance: Conduct thorough inspections of workmanship and materials, identifying and addressing any deficiencies promptly to uphold the integrity and longevity of installed systems.
  6. Client Communication: Serve as the primary point of contact for clients, providing regular updates on project progress, addressing any concerns or issues, and ensuring customer satisfaction throughout the project lifecycle.
  7. Documentation Management: Maintain accurate records of project activities, including daily reports, site logs, and as-built drawings, to facilitate communication, track progress, and support claims and change orders.
  8. Team Development: Mentor and coach site personnel, fostering a culture of accountability, teamwork, and continuous improvement to enhance performance and drive excellence in project execution.

Requirements:

  • Construction Management Experience: Proven experience in site management, preferably in the installation of flat roofing and waterproofing systems or related construction projects.
  • Technical Knowledge: Strong understanding of waterproofing systems, construction techniques, and industry best practices, with the ability to interpret design drawings and specifications.
  • Leadership Skills: Excellent leadership and communication skills, with the ability to motivate and inspire teams to achieve project goals while maintaining a positive and collaborative work environment.
  • Problem-Solving Abilities: Effective problem-solving skills, with the ability to anticipate and resolve challenges encountered during project execution and make informed decisions under pressure.
  • Health and Safety Certification: Valid certification in health and safety management (e.g., SMSTS, CSCS, First Aid) is preferred.
